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
299920704 850 635689 4545894 8763363504
406889994 49043 162534
406889994 49043 162534
0715946149 866 617646 9208524343 560
All about undefined
Interested in learning more?
406889994 49043 162534
0715946149 866 617646 9208524343 560
See more
76500417 0325714
278 986001 6316
See more
10165609138 4941622678
795259395 65951283770 48923
See more